Chapter 6

Delilah's POV

"Let's get something straight right now," Dante said as he leaned forward with his storm gray eyes boring into mine with pure hatred. "We don't want you here. We don't want your mother here either. This is our home and our mother's home. You're both intruders who don't belong."

"But there's a problem," Mateo added in a conversational tone like he was discussing the weather. "Our father is too obsessed with your mother to see reason right now. We can't get rid of her directly because he's completely blind when it comes to her."

My heart pounded harder and I didn't like where this was going at all.

"That's where you come in." Dante's smile was cruel and cold as he studied me like a predator sizing up prey. "You're the weak link in this whole situation. The pathetic little reject who got thrown away by her own fated mate. You're already broken and it won't take much to break you completely."

"We're going to make your life here so miserable that eventually your mother will have to choose," Mateo said with his amber eyes gleaming with malice. "You or our father. And any good mother would choose her daughter over a new mate she's only known for six months."

"She'll leave," Dante continued. "She'll take you and run just like you both ran from Riverbend. And our father will finally see what a massive mistake this whole thing was."

"What did I ever do to you?" My voice came out small and broken.

"You exist." Dante stood abruptly and looked down at me with disgust. "You and your mother came into our lives and tried to erase our real mother's memory like she never mattered. That's more than enough."

"Every single day we're going to remind you that you don't belong here," Mateo said as he stood beside his brother with both of them towering over me. "That you're worthless. That even your own fated mate didn't want you enough to keep you. We'll make sure everyone in this pack knows exactly what you are."

Dante leaned down and placed both hands on the table in front of me, bringing his face close to mine. "We'll tell them how your mate rejected you publicly. How he chose your bully over you. How you came crawling here with nowhere else to go because even your own pack threw you out like garbage."

My stomach dropped and my skin went cold. How did they know about Sarah? How did they know she was the one who beat me? 

I knew it could be possible they'd heard about the rejection but these were details that shouldn't have spread. Personal, intimate details about the worst moment of my life.

Wait! Did they have spies monitoring our every movement?

"How do you know all that?" My voice shook.

"We know everything," Mateo said with a cruel smile. "We know he was fucking her the whole time. We know she beat you bloody in that bathroom just hours before the ceremony. We know exactly what he said to you in front of everyone."

They knew every detail. Every humiliating, painful detail that I wanted to bury and forget. Someone had talked or the gossip had spread faster and further than I thought possible.

"We'll make sure they know you're damaged goods," Mateo continued. "A reject who couldn't even keep her fated mate interested. The whole pack will look at you the way Riverbend did, with pity and disgust."

"Every training session, every pack gathering, every single interaction will be a reminder that you're not wanted," Dante said with his voice low and threatening. "We'll make your mother watch as you suffer. We'll make her see that staying here means watching her daughter be destroyed piece by piece."

"And when she finally can't take it anymore and chooses to leave with you, our father will see her for what she really is," Mateo said. "A woman who was never committed to him in the first place."

"Either way, we win," Dante straightened and looked down at me with cold satisfaction. "You either break and convince your mother to leave, or you stay and suffer while we make your life a living hell. The choice is yours, step-sister."

"And when you finally break and your mother takes you away from here, we'll have our home back," Dante said with his voice ice cold. "The way it should be. The way it was before you came and ruined everything."

Both brothers walked out and left me alone in the dining room with their threats hanging in the air like poison.

I sat there trembling with my hands clenched in my lap. They knew everything about my rejection, every humiliating detail including Sarah and the beating. And they were going to use it all as weapons to destroy me in front of this entire pack.

I pushed back from the table and made my way upstairs to my room on shaking legs. I changed into an oversized shirt for sleeping and crawled into bed, pulling my grandmother's quilt around me while their words echoed in my head.

A soft knock on my door made me sit up.

"Delilah?" Mom's voice came through. "Can I come in?"

"Yeah."

Mom entered with a soft smile on her face and sat down on the edge of my bed. Her copper-red hair was loose around her shoulders now and she looked more relaxed than I'd seen her in years. "The gardens are beautiful, sweetheart. Ryker showed me the moon flowers and I think we're going to be so happy here."

I looked at her hopeful face and felt my chest tighten with panic. I couldn't let Dante and Mateo do this to us. I couldn't let them use me to hurt her.

"Mom, we need to leave." The words rushed out before I could stop them. "The guys aren't what you think they are. After you and Ryker left dinner, they cornered me and told me that they're going to-"

A knock on the door interrupted me and before either of us could respond, the door opened.

Mateo stepped inside carrying a glass of milk and his amber eyes locked onto mine immediately. The look he gave me made my blood turn to ice. It was a death stare that promised consequences and pain if I said another word.
